'Intro - At the Fathomless Depths' serves as a prelude to Dissection's seminal album, 'Storm of the Light's Bane,' released in 1995. The band, known for their unique blend of black metal and melodic death metal, utilizes this track to set an atmospheric tone for the album. The song features haunting soundscapes and orchestral elements, creating an immersive experience that encapsulates the essence of the band's style. As an introductory piece, it draws listeners into the thematic exploration that unfolds in the subsequent tracks, establishing a dark and brooding ambiance that is characteristic of Dissection's work.
Thematically, 'Intro - At the Fathomless Depths' delves into concepts of existential despair and the search for meaning beneath the surface of existence. While the song itself is instrumental, its title and the accompanying sound evoke a sense of depth and introspection that aligns with the lyrical content found throughout 'Storm of the Light's Bane.' The idea of exploring fathomless depths can be interpreted as a metaphor for delving into one’s subconscious or confronting the darker aspects of human existence. This exploration of existential themes resonates throughout the album, particularly in tracks like 'Where Dead Angels Lie,' where the duality of beauty and despair is examined.
The critical reception of 'Storm of the Light's Bane' and its introductory track has cemented Dissection's legacy in the metal genre. The album is frequently cited as one of the most influential black metal records, and 'Intro - At the Fathomless Depths' has been praised for its ability to evoke emotion and set the stage for the darker themes explored in the album. Over the years, fans and critics alike have lauded Dissection for their innovative approach to songwriting and their ability to combine aggression with melody. This track, while not a standalone song in the traditional sense, plays a pivotal role in the overall impact of the album, which continues to resonate with listeners and inspire new generations of musicians within the metal community.
